Every year, Refugee Week provides an important opportunity to reflect on the experiences of displaced people worldwide and celebrate their fortitude. This year, the focus turns to a powerful and universal theme: Courage.
To mark the occasion here in West Sussex, local charity Worthing 4 Refugees is hosting a week-long exhibition at Colonnade House titled “The Art of Courage.” Running from Tuesday, 16 June to Saturday, 20 June 2026, more than just an exhibit, this space is a neighbourhood gathering place where different cultures and stories connect.
A Shared Creative Space
What makes “The Art of Courage” particularly moving is its joint nature. The exhibition brings together an eclectic collection of art and craft, featuring:
- Original work created by refugees and displaced persons now living within our communities.
- Pieces contributed by local Worthing artists, created in a spirit of welcome and solidarity.
Rather than just a static display, the gallery serves as a space to honour resilience, share highly personal stories, and build confidence among various cultures. For visitors, it gives a window into the real experiences of those who have had to leave everything behind, expressed through paint, textiles, and a variety of craft media.
About the Organisers
The exhibition is curated by Worthing 4 Refugees, a dedicated local organisation working to establish a culture of safety, integration, and justice across the town. Powered by volunteers and working in close partnership with local groups, the charity provides vital practical services to help refugees and asylum seekers find their feet, connect with neighbours, and begin the next chapter of their lives in safety.
